Types of Washing Machines | Top-Loading vs Front-Loading

Top-loading washing machines are traditional models where clothes are loaded from the top. They are generally more affordable and have shorter cycle times. On the other hand, front-loading washing machines, which require you to pack clothes from the front, are known for their efficiency. They use less water, detergent, and energy, making them a more eco-friendly choice. Issues Due to Lack of Cleaning

Regular cleaning of your washing machine is crucial to prevent common problems such as unpleasant odors and residue build-up. Lack of cleaning can cause detergent and fabric softener residue to accumulate, creating an environment conducive to mold and mildew. This produces a foul smell and affects the machine’s performance and lifespan. List of Required Cleaning Materials

To thoroughly clean your washing machine, gather the following materials: Affresh washing machine cleaner, rubber gloves to protect your hands, clean and dry cloth for wiping, and a scrub brush to reach and clean stubborn areas and residue. Keep white vinegar, baking soda, and bleach close by; these natural cleaning agents work great for deep cleaning and eliminating hard-to-remove odors.

Safety Precautions and Tips.

Safety is paramount when undertaking any cleaning task. Before starting, unplug the washing machine to prevent any electrical hazards. Remember to wear rubber gloves to protect your hands from harsh cleaning agents. Don’t mix cleaning agents like vinegar and bleach; they can generate toxic fumes. Lastly, ensure the area is well-ventilated to avoid inhalation of strong odors from the cleaners.

Cleaning Guide for Top-Loading and Front-Loading Machines.

For top-loading machines, start by setting the washer to its hottest, highest-capacity setting. Place one Affresh washing machine cleaner tablet into the drum and run the cycle. Once completed, use a clean cloth to wipe away any residue within the drum. Place the Affresh tablet into the detergent drawer for front-loading machines and run a similar cycle. Ensure to clean the rubber seal around the door afterward, as this area is prone to mold and mildew build-up.

Emphasis on Areas Often Overlooked

When cleaning with Affresh washing machine cleaner, it’s vital to recognize some commonly neglected areas, such as the gaskets and dispensers. These components often harbor grime and detergent residue that can lead to malodors and hamper effective functioning.

The gasket, the rubber seal around the door in front-loading machines, is a hot spot for mold and mildew. Ensure to wipe it thoroughly with a cloth after the cleaning cycle. Likewise, dispensers for detergent and fabric softener can accumulate residue over time. Remove these components if possible and soak them in warm water and vinegar before scrubbing clean. Regularly cleaning these often-overlooked areas can significantly enhance your washing machine’s performance and lifespan.

Eco-friendly Cleaning with Vinegar and Baking Soda

To utilize vinegar and baking soda for eco-friendly cleaning, start by adding half a cup of baking soda and two cups of white vinegar to the drum of the washing machine. Run a hot water cycle, allowing the natural cleaning agents to dissolve grime and eliminate odors. After the process, wipe the drum clean with a cloth.

Maintenance Tips to Avoid Mold and Residue Accumulation

Regularly air out your washing machine to prevent mold and residue build-up by leaving the door open between washes. This action dries out the interior and hampers mold growth.

Secondly, clean the detergent dispenser and other removable parts monthly, and use Affresh washing machine cleaner or vinegar and baking soda every few months for a deep cleanse.

Advice on How Often to Clean the Machine Based On Usage.

The frequency of cleaning your washing machine relies heavily on its usage. For commercial or high-use machines common in businesses, a deep clean using Affresh washing machine cleaner is recommended once every month. Alternatively, a thorough cleaning every three months should suffice for less frequently used machines. Observing this cleaning regimen ensures optimal efficiency and longevity of your machine.

Despite regular cleaning, persistent odors or stains can sometimes afflict your washing machine. Consider running an additional cycle with Affresh washing machine cleaner or a homemade vinegar and baking soda solution for stubborn smells. If stains remain, try using a soft brush and a solution of warm water and mild detergent to gently scrub the affected areas. Remember, consistent maintenance can prevent such issues from reoccurring.

When to Seek Professional Help.

When persistent issues persist after thorough cleaning and maintenance, it may be time to seek professional help. Should your washing machine exhibit erratic behavior, unusual noises, or water leakage, these could indicate more serious underlying issues. Engaging an experienced technician ensures safe, accurate diagnosis and repair, thus preserving your machine’s functionality and lifespan.
